Skip to content

The AsyncAPI specification allows you to create machine-readable definitions of your asynchronous APIs.

License

Notifications You must be signed in to change notification settings

asyncapi/spec

This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.

Folders and files

NameName
Last commit message
Last commit date
May 24, 2021
Nov 6, 2019
Mar 16, 2021
May 24, 2021
May 28, 2021
Jun 3, 2020
Mar 19, 2019
May 24, 2021
Apr 20, 2021
Feb 2, 2019
Mar 16, 2021

Repository files navigation


AsyncAPI logo


IQVIA logo      Mulesoft logo      Salesforce logo      SAP logo   Slack logo   Solace logo   TIBCO logo

πŸ™Œ Platinum sponsors. Join them! πŸ™Œ

Read the specification

The latest draft specification can be found at spec/asyncapi.md which tracks the latest commit to the master branch in this repository.

Looking for the JSON Schema files? Check out our asyncapi-node repo.

Feel like contributing? Check out our community repo.

Examples

πŸ’‘ Streetlights

Demonstrates how to use AsyncAPI to define an API that controls city streetlights.

πŸ‘‰ See more

Slack icon   Slack Events API

Partial definition of the Slack Events API. Find the official one here.

πŸ‘‰ See more

Gitter icon   Gitter Streaming API

Definition of the Gitter streaming API.

πŸ‘‰ See more

βž• and more...

Check out the examples directory for more examples.

Contributors

Thanks goes to these wonderful people (emoji key):


Lukasz Gornicki

πŸ“– πŸ€” πŸ‘€ πŸ’» πŸ’¬ πŸ“‹ πŸ–‹ πŸ“ πŸ”§

Mike Ralphson

πŸ’¬ πŸ“– πŸ’» πŸ€” πŸš‡ πŸ‘€ ⚠️ πŸ”§ 🚧 πŸ“‹

raisel melian

πŸ’¬ πŸ› πŸ’» πŸ“– πŸ€” 🚧 πŸ‘€ πŸ”§ ⚠️

Fran MΓ©ndez

πŸ’¬ πŸ› πŸ“ πŸ’Ό πŸ’» πŸ–‹ πŸ“– 🎨 πŸ’΅ πŸ” πŸ€” πŸš‡ 🚧 πŸ”Œ πŸ‘€ πŸ”§ ⚠️ βœ… πŸ“’ πŸ“‹

dulce

🎨

Chris Wood

πŸ’» πŸ€” πŸ“–

Jonathan Schabowsky

πŸ“– πŸ” πŸ€”

Victor Romero

πŸ€” πŸ‘€

Antonio Garrote

πŸ€” πŸ‘€

Jonathan Stoikovitch

πŸ” πŸ’‘ πŸ€” πŸ‘€

Jonas Lagoni

πŸ› πŸ’» πŸ“– πŸ€” πŸ’¬ πŸ“‹

Eva

πŸ€” πŸ’Ό πŸ“‹

Waleed Ashraf

πŸ“’ πŸ”§ πŸ“‹

Andrzej Jarzyna

πŸ“’ πŸ“‹

Emmelyn Wang

πŸ“ πŸ“‹ πŸ€” πŸ“– πŸ“’

Marc DiPasquale

πŸ“ πŸ“’ πŸ‘€ πŸ› πŸ€” πŸ“Ή

This project follows the all-contributors specification. Contributions of any kind welcome!